CVG airport has one main terminal with four concourses

The Cincinnati/Northern Kentucky International Airport (CVG) is located in Boone County, Kentucky, United States, serving the Cincinnati tri-state area. The airport's code, CVG, is derived from Covington, Kentucky, the nearest city when the airport opened. Covering an area of 7,000 acres, it is the 6th busiest airport in the US by cargo traffic and the 12th largest in the world.

Concourse A has 24 gates, numbered A1 to A24, and houses Graeter's Ice Cream at Gate A13. There is also a children's play area near Gate A4 and an information booth in the food court.

Concourse B has 28 gates, numbered B1 to B28, with gates B1 to B12 on the west side and B13 to B28 on the east side. This concourse receives all international flights, and passengers are required to clear security upon arrival before proceeding to baggage claim or onward flight connections. There is a good selection of shops and restaurants in Concourse B, along with a Delta Sky Club and an Escape Lounge near Gate B21. Additionally, there is an interfaith meditation room with prayer rugs located near Gate B14, and foreign currency services near the entrance to Gate B12.

The main terminal's baggage claim is located on Level 1, with an information booth, a lost and found office, and a small selection of services and facilities. The east and west ground transportation areas can be accessed from either end of baggage claim. Airline ticketing is on Level 2, along with a few shops and an ATM.

The airport offers various parking options

The Cincinnati/Northern Kentucky International Airport (CVG) offers a range of parking options to suit different needs and budgets. The airport's parking facilities are open 24/7 and are well-lit, secure, and offer fast assistance with car trouble and handicap accessibility. Here are the parking options available:

CVG Terminal Garage

The CVG Terminal Garage is located on C Level, Rows 28-29, and offers convenient parking close to the terminal. The daily rate for this parking option is $27 per day.

CVG ValuPark Lot

The CVG ValuPark Lot is a more economical option, with a daily rate of $12. This lot offers a good balance between convenience and affordability.

CVG Economy Lot

For those looking for the most budget-friendly option, the CVG Economy Lot is available at a daily rate of $10. While it may be a bit further from the terminal, it still offers easy access to the airport.

Valet Parking

CVG also offers valet parking services for travellers who want added convenience. The exact rates for valet parking are not readily available, but it is a good option for those who want to drop off their car and head straight to their flight.

Free Cell Phone Lot

For those picking up passengers, CVG provides a free cell phone lot. This lot allows you to wait for your arriving party without incurring any parking fees.

In addition to these options, CVG also has a Parking Advantage Program that allows members to collect points with each stay, which can be redeemed for free parking and exclusive perks. This program offers express lane access, online account management, and the convenience of using a frequent parker card system for access to all parking areas.

Taxis are available 24/7

If you're arriving at or departing from Cincinnati/Northern Kentucky International Airport (CVG) and need a taxi, you'll be glad to know that taxis are available 24/7. You can find taxis in the ground transportation area of the terminal, and you don't need to worry about making a reservation as they are readily available on a first-come, first-served basis. All taxis are metered, so you'll be charged based on the distance travelled. A typical one-way fare from the airport to downtown Cincinnati is around $34 to $35.

When you arrive at the airport, you'll find the taxi pick-up zone in Zone 2. This is a designated area where taxis wait to pick up passengers. It's conveniently located near the terminal, so you won't have to walk far with your luggage. The taxi drivers are experienced in serving airport passengers and can provide a comfortable and efficient ride to your destination.

If you prefer a more luxurious option, executive van and car services are also available at CVG. These can be booked at service desks located in the baggage claim area. This option might be ideal if you're travelling with a larger group or simply prefer a more spacious and premium vehicle. The executive car service providers typically offer a range of vehicle options, from sleek sedans to spacious SUVs or vans, ensuring that you travel in comfort and style.

The airport has private work booths for rent

The Cincinnati/Northern Kentucky International Airport (CVG) is a bustling hub, serving around 20,000 passengers daily. For those seeking a quiet and private space to work, the airport offers an innovative solution—private work booths for rent. These booths, known as "jabbrrboxes", are strategically located throughout the airport, providing a convenient option for travellers who need a productive space.

These private work booths are fully equipped for all your business needs. Each booth features its own secure Wi-Fi network, Bluetooth connectivity, speakers, and a camera, enabling you to connect and collaborate seamlessly. Whether you're a business traveller or simply need a quiet space to focus, these work booths offer the perfect environment.

The booths are designed with functionality in mind. Their soundproof construction ensures privacy and minimal distractions, allowing you to concentrate on your tasks without the hustle and bustle of the airport interfering. The video conferencing and private call capabilities make them ideal for remote workers or those who need to connect with colleagues and clients remotely.

Renting a private work booth at CVG is a straightforward process. With rates starting at $15 for 30 minutes, you can choose the duration that suits your needs, ranging from 30 minutes to 2 hours. This flexibility caters to travellers with varying requirements, whether you're looking for a quick check-in with your team or need a more extended period to focus on a project.
